What has Mayor Cantrell done with all the money?

The City Council has had a difficult time getting information about the city’s budget deficit from the Cantrell Administration. How could it be so much larger than expected, an estimated $160 million dollars? Contributing factors reportedly include personnel & OT costs (for public safety responses to events like the New Year’s attack), revenue shortfalls, and an underfunded pension fund. How do you lose control to that extent? Who’s watching the people’s money?
